Help with wire ID's
I am working on installing new engine and front lighting harnesses on my 71 base GT-37. I can't tell from my shop manual what the two plugs below connect to:
1)The first and second pictures below show one that has a BLACK AND DARK BLUE wire on top and on the bottom side something attached that looks like it is wrapped in black plastic. Can anyone tell me what this is for? 2) The third picture is actually bright ORANGE. Does it plug into the middle prong on the Horn relay? |

I would say the #2 is for the horn relay.
The #1 I'm not sure, but could be for the TSC switch? But I've never seen that kind of connector from the factory? Looks like aftermarket? But there is a dark blue and black wire that goes to the TSC switch with the blue going to the temp switch and the black going to the tranny. Maybe follow the wires to see where they go?
